speed control of bldc motor using pwm
Thanks for contributing an answer to Electrical Engineering Stack Exchange! The First Maker-Friendly Guide to Electric Motors! Makers can do amazing things with motors. Yes, they’re more complicated than some other circuit elements, but with this book, you can completely master them. Proportional-integral (PI) control with hysteresis or pulse width modulation (PWM) switching is the most widely used speed control technique for BLDC motors with trapezoidal back EMF. Bridging Wireless Communications Design and Testing with MATLAB. The Pulse Width Modulation (PWM) Mode Speed control of DC motor by PWM in Proteus simulation, Simple Digital Current Meter (DCM) using PIC microcontroller (Schematic + code + Proteus simulation). In this paper the simulation of BLDC motor is done using soft commutating technique (Proteus Design Suit & Keil uVision3 software). This example shows how to control the rotor speed in a BLDC based electrical drive. [1] Speed Control of a BLDC Motor Using PWM Control Technique Arjun V N1, Akhilesh H Nair1, Balakrishnan G1, Vishnu T S1, Vidya Sojan2. BLDC motors have permanent magnets that rotate (rotor) and a fixed armature (stator). It is mandatory to procure user consent prior to running these cookies on your website. At 100% torque the maximum voltage is being applied. The signal created by the PWM Generator fluctuates between 0 and 1 and controls the on and off duration of the two switches of the buck converter. Found inside – Page 94The software is designed in the integration of the CCS3.3 DSP software, and through the hardware of simulation, test program. ... BLDC motor control with energy materials mainly including PWM produce, commutation and speed adjustment. DC Motor speed control Circuit using IC 555. In this article, we will explain how to get a PWM from the AVR Atmega32 and we shalll apply the output PWM to a small DC motor to vary its speed. There are various PWM techniques, among these sinusoidal PWM method and space vector PWM methods are mostly used today. SVPWM inverter gives better dc-bus voltage utilization, lower switching losses and better harmonic performance in comparison to the carrier based sine PWM inverter. Speed Control Of BLDC MOTOR By Using PsoC . This loop's PI controller gains are selected to calculate voltage from current-error. In fact, the red boxes clearly mark and label the two loops as speed control loop and current control loop. SHIVAM SINGH (EN NO.121110109045) 2. Speed Control of DC Motor using Arduino. In this simulation, we used an ideal voltage source which let us generate different DC voltage levels commanded by the controller. 2. Now that we’ve discussed PWM conceptually, we’ll look at two common architectures used to implement PWM. Should I divide output from first PI controller by mechanical constant or not ? 2.1.2 Speed Control Commutation ensures the proper rotor rotation of the BLDC motor, while the motor speed only depends on the amplitude of the appl ied voltage. The speed sensed by the IR The second one shows us the modulated DC voltage by the buck converter. In this circuit, for controlling the speed of DC motor, we use a 100K ohm potentiometer to change the duty cycle of the PWM signal. 100K ohm potentiometer is connected to the analog input pin A0 of the Arduino UNO and the DC motor is connected to the 12 th pin of the Arduino (which is the PWM pin). I think that It should be conversely. This project describes the speed control of BLDC motor with the dsPIC30F4011 Digital Signal Controller. MathWorks is the leading developer of mathematical computing software for engineers and scientists. Stack Exchange network consists of 178 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. Now let's imagine that speed error is 0, then PI output should be equal to 1000 (duty cycle = 100%). However, after the BLDC motor obtains a steady rotation, we can infer the internal angle and exchange to the SPWM mode. The microcontroller receives the percentage of duty cycles from the keypad and delivers the desired output to switch the motor driver so as to control the speed of the BLDC motor. Using this clue, we can simply figure out what the effective voltage is during the rest of the commutated phases. The speed control of BLDC motor with SVPWM inverter gives better utilization of dc link input voltage, lesser switching losses, and lesser total harmonic distortion than the other PWM techniques [4]. The PI controller gains are designed to directly give the voltage required to control the motor. But logic will remain the same. So the error signal is fed to a PI controller followed by a gain (\$T^* / K_T\$) to calculate the current needed to be fed to the motor. The control system is developed based on speed control loop, current control loop and ... the produced speed error is processed in PI speed controller. In the first one, we use a buck converter along with a PWM generator to step down the DC source voltage to the three-phase inverter. Read white paper. Use PWM signals to control the breakover time of triode and change the value of control voltage for realization. Torque increases when current increases. With PWM, we’re able to adjust a constant DC voltage to different voltage levels. Hello friends here is a proteus simulation of speed control of DC motor with the help of Pulse width modulation (PWM) control, PWM signals are generated by 8051 microcontroller. This model consists of similar blocks that we saw in the previous video except this part where we implement PWM control by using a buck converter. Master's Thesis from the year 2014 in the subject Electrotechnology, grade: Distinction, University of Newcastle upon Tyne, language: English, abstract: The aim of this project is to control speed of permanent magnet DC motor by using ... The BLDC system is only allowed to operate at a low duty (DL) or a high duty (DH). The bigger error, the bigger duty cycle. Speed Control of BLDC Motor using PWM Technique.pdf. Tittle: Speed control of BLDC Motor by using PWM current controller technique for electric vehicle propulsion Million Gerado Geda Thesis Submitted to The department of Electrical Power and Control Engineering School of Electrical Engineering and Computing Presented in Partial Fulfillment of the Requirement for the Degree of Master's in To get this averaging effect right, we should be careful when selecting the PWM frequency, which is computed by 1/period. ALOK THAKUR (EN NO.121110109022) 4. To achieve this there are two modes. From what I understand, if the duty cycle is higher than 50%, the negative voltage (low state) is applied for a shorter duration than the positive voltage (high state). DC Motor Control Unit for an Old Controller. PWM MANAGEMENT FOR 3-PHASE BLDC MOTOR DRIVES USING THE ST7MC 2 SIX-STEP, 120° DRIVE AND PWM POWER CONTROL To control a BLDC motor with the best efficiency, we have to know the rotor position at all times. Found inside – Page 216Unipolar PWM predictive current-mode control of a variable-speed low inductance BLDC motor drive. ... Improvement of time response for sensorless control of BLDC Motor drive using ant colony optimization technique, International Journal ...
What Does A Kansas Marriage Certificate Look Like, Dusit Thani Cebu Day Use Rate 2021, Cactus Jack Car Travis Scott, Parrot Uncle Remote Not Working, Terremark Data Center Miami, Assessment And Evaluation In Mathematics, Retina Display Resolution Vs 1080p, Can A Physical Therapist Request An Mri, Tampa Bay Buccaneers Stats Tonight, Kindergarten Growing Success, Who Caused The Explosion That Killed Josh In Neighbours, Take Action Project Ideas For Juniors, Navair University Login, Wisconsin Dells Population 2021,